Elevated Dishwashers Add Convenience to Your Kitchen

One of the greatest trends in dishwashers for today’s kitchen is the elevated dishwasher which makes loading and unloading the dishwasher much easier. Most elevated dishwashers are raised off the floor anywhere from six to eighteen inches.

Tips for Microwave Cooking Success

Choose a microwave with the highest wattage you can get. The more capability the microwave has to heat at a high level, the better the performance, and the faster it will cook.

Induction Cooktops

Replacing your existing cooktop with a new induction cooktop during a kitchen remodeling project can make cooking much more enjoyable for you. Induction cooktops utilize molecular movement which actually heats the cooking vessel versus the burner and allows a better distribution of heat so food cooks more evenly.
